Top 10 Automobiles and parts in Summerville SC

Automaxx of Summerville
Automaxx of Summerville
1016 N Main St
Summerville, SC 29483
Summerville Automobiles and parts

Whitewall Choppers
Whitewall Choppers
195 Farmington Rd
Summerville, SC 29486
Summerville Automobiles and parts

Results 1 - 2 of 2